Description: INTRODUCTION TO WAVES & PHOTONICS ***** Introduction to the concepts of waves and oscillatory motion with a partcular focus on electromagnetic waves and their interaction with dielectric materials, and on the use of these ideas in the fields of optical fiber communications laser design, non-linear optics, and Fourier optics. ***** Instructor(s): Mittleman
